New details from guests who attended the closely guarded New York ceremony suggest the event balanced blockbuster star power with a surprisingly intimate atmosphere inside Madison Square Garden.
The pair, both 36, married on Friday night in a secretive celebration at the iconic venue, where guests were reportedly asked to follow a strict no-phones policy. That decision kept most of the ceremony out of public view until attendees began sharing carefully worded reactions the following day.
A star-studded wedding that still felt personal
Although the guest list reportedly stretched to around 1,000 people, those present described the ceremony as deeply emotional rather than overly extravagant. Television host George Stephanopoulos said the event was beautiful and moving, while Robin Roberts remarked that, despite the scale and celebrity presence, it still felt like a real wedding in the most familiar sense.
Guests said Swift and Kelce wrote their own vows and read them from small books during the ceremony, adding a personal touch to an event already steeped in anticipation. Adam Sandler reportedly officiated, while Stevie Nicks is said to have delivered a special performance for the couple.

Celebrity guests and memorable details emerge
The wedding brought together a remarkable mix of famous names from entertainment, sport and television. Reports indicate guests included Gigi Hadid, Bradley Cooper, Ed Sheeran, Graham Norton, Hugh Grant and Ethan Hawke. As celebrations ended, more stars were seen leaving the venue, including Reese Witherspoon, Brad Pitt, Steven Spielberg, Tom Hanks, Millie Bobby Brown and Jennifer Lopez.
Several attendees offered glimpses of the night through social media posts after the event. Greg James confirmed he had been invited and described the evening as brilliant, while other guests hinted at the lavish but carefully curated atmosphere. One keepsake shared online appeared to feature the couple’s wedding insignia, the date and location, and a lyric referencing Swift’s song Blank Space.
Further reports suggest Kelce’s nieces served as flower girls, while Swift walked down the aisle accompanied by a string quartet playing one of her own songs. Outside the venue, a billboard reading “JUST&T MARRIED” added another theatrical flourish to the celebration.

Philanthropy and the story behind the celebration
Beyond the glamour, the couple had already made headlines before the wedding by reportedly donating 26 million dollars to 20 charities. The beneficiaries included food banks, children’s hospitals, educational programmes and an animal welfare organisation. That charitable gesture added another layer to public interest in the wedding and helped shape the tone of coverage around the event.
Cleanup crews were seen dismantling the elaborate set-up on Saturday, removing furniture, decorative installations and monogrammed elements from the arena. By then, the celebration itself had already moved from private ceremony to global conversation.
